Oklahoma Code § 19-864.14

Title 19. Counties And County Officers: Exceptions

The provisions of this act shall not apply to:
1.  Buildings owned by the federal government.
2.  Installation, alteration or repair of electrical equipment
and devices by municipalities for street lighting or traffic signal
systems.
3.  Vehicles, boats or airplanes.
4.  Integral parts of communications systems of telephone or
telegraph companies.
5.  Communications systems of railroads or pipeline companies,
or oil or gas producers.
6.  Public utilities systems subject to the regulations of the
Corporation Commission and rural electric cooperatives in the
generation, transmission and distribution of electricity.
7.  Persons performing electrical work on integral components of
equipment for which they have been otherwise qualified by
examination of other competent bodies.
8.  Any person engaged only in the work of operating any of the
electrical installation in a factory, refinery, office building,
school district, institution of higher learning, hospital or
eleemosynary institution or any facility thereof; provided he shall
be hired by only one entity and shall not establish an electrical
business nor be able to assume any electrical contracting functions.
9.  Elevator construction contractors and/or elevator
construction journeymen in those jurisdictions of the city, county
or metropolitan area which otherwise provides for licensing and
inspection thereof by separate ordinance or resolution, and
authority to so exempt and establish such licensing and inspection
code by such enactment is hereby granted to such government
entities.
